Georgia State vs Georgia Southern 2/17/22 College Basketball Picks, Predictions, Odds

Georgia Southern Eagles (11-12) vs. Georgia State Panthers (11-10)
February 17, 2022 7:00 pm EDT
The Line: Georgia State Panthers -9.5 / Georgia Southern Eagles +9.5; Over/Under: 129.5

The Georgia Southern Eagles will travel to GSU Sports Arena to take on the Georgia State Panthers this Thursday night in College Basketball action.

The Georgia Southern Eagles lost their 3rd straight game and dropped to 11-12 on the season after being defeated by the Coastal Carolina Chanticleers, 79-58, this past Saturday. Georgia Southern struggled on both ends of the court and could not fight back after Coastal Carolina took a 58-38 lead with 9:55 left in regulation. Georgia Southern shot 34.0% from the field & 27.3% from beyond the arc while allowing Coastal Carolina to shoot 54.0% from the field & 54.5% from beyond the arc. Leading the way for the Eagles was Elijah McCadden who had 14 points, 2 rebounds, 3 assists, & 1 steal.

On the season, Georgia Southern is averaging 66.7 ppg on 45.7% shooting from the field. The Eagles are averaging 5.6 three-pointers per game on 29.5% shooting from beyond the arc. Offensively, Georgia Southern has been led by Elijah McCadden (11.8 ppg, 4.3 rpg, 2.2 apg, 1.0 spg), Andrei Savrasov (10.2 ppg, 5.6 rpg), Kamari Brown (9.6 ppg, 3.7 rpg, 1.6 apg), & Cam Bryant (7.9 ppg, 3.9 rpg, 1.8 apg).

Defensively, Georgia Southern is holding their opponents to an average of 64.0 ppg on 40.9% shooting from the field The Eagles have a rebound margin of 2.6 and a turnover margin of -0.5.

The Georgia State Panthers won their 3rd straight game and improved to 11-10 on the season after defeating the Appalachian State Mountaineers, 58-49, this past Saturday. Georgia State was outstanding defensively against Appalachian State and had no trouble securing the victory after going into halftime with a 28-16 lead. Georgia State shot 32.1% from the field & 19.2% from beyond the arc while holding Appalachian State to 30.6% shooting from the field & 35.0% from beyond the arc. Leading the way for the Panthers was Jalen Thomas who had 16 points, 5 rebounds, & 2 blocks.

On the season, Georgia State is averaging 70.3 ppg on 39.8% shooting from the field. The Panthers are averaging 7.8 three-pointers per game on 31.7% shooting from beyond the arc. Offensively, Georgia State has been led by Corey Allen (13.9 ppg, 3.8 rpg, 3.0 apg, 1.8 spg), Kane Williams (12.3 ppg, 4.0 rpg, 3.7 apg, 1.7 spg), Justin Roberts (11.8 ppg, 3.0 rpg, 2.3 apg, 1.3 spg), & Eliel Nsoseme (8.2 ppg, 10.2 rpg, 1.4 bpg).

Defensively, Georgia State is holding their opponents to an average of 65.4 ppg on 41.4% shooting from the field. The Panthers have a rebound margin of 0.6 and a turnover margin of 5.3.

The Eagles are 4-1 ATS in their last 5 road games & 4-0 ATS in their last 4 games following a straight up loss of more than 20 points. The Panthers are 5-1 ATS in their last 6 games overall, however, are just 1-4 ATS in their last 5 home games.

Georgia Southern has been decent on the defensive end this season, however, the Eagles have struggled putting points up on the board as they come into this game ranked just 284th in scoring offense and have lost 6 of their last 9 games. Georgia State is playing their best basketball of the season as of late, led by their defense which ranks 75th in scoring defense & 87th in defensive FG%, and after seeing the Panthers coming off convincing road victories against Coastal Carolina & Appalachian State, I think Georgia State wins this one by double-digits and covers this home spread.
